Shoigu: Situation in Central Asia causes concern

Radical groups belonging to foreign terrorist organizations and concentrated in the north of Afghanistan have stepped up their activities aimed at the Central Asian republics. Russian Defense Minister Sergei Shoigu stated this on Friday at a meeting of the heads of military agencies of the SCO countries in New Delhi, RIA Novosti reports.


According to him, “the likelihood of infiltration by militants of various foreign terrorist organizations, such as ISIS, Al-Qaeda, the Islamic Movement of Uzbekistan and the Islamic Movement of East Turkestan, is increasing.” “This means that we should clearly coordinate and step up our efforts to counter terrorism, separatism and extremism, and develop measures to stabilize the situation in the region,” Shoigu added.


He noted the importance of keeping the topic of Afghanistan on the SCO agenda.


“Without comprehensive international and regional assistance, it will be difficult for this country to cope with the challenges on its own,” the head of the Russian defence ministry concluded.
